Usually a clear, viscous liquid or white powder, potassium silicate is an inorganic substance made up of potassium oxide (K2O) and silica (SiO2). In industrial settings, it is frequently employed as an adhesive, corrosion inhibitor, and binder. As a soluble source of silicon and potassium, it improves plant growth and insect resistance in agriculture. Because of its resilience at high temperatures, potassium silicate is also used in welding rods, coatings, and refractories. Even though it is non-toxic, its alkalinity and potential to irritate skin or eyes when in touch make it necessary to handle it carefully and use protective gear in industrial and agricultural contexts.

Propionitrile (CH3CH2CN) is a colorless, ether-like liquid that is volatile. It is mostly utilized in organic synthesis as an intermediate in the manufacturing of fine chemicals, including insecticides and medications, and is a member of the nitrile family. Its capacity to efficiently dissolve organic compounds makes it a useful solvent for resins, dyes, and polymers. Because it is combustible and somewhat poisonous, proponitrile needs to be handled and stored carefully. Extended exposure may result in respiratory, ocular, or skin irritation. It is an important molecule in many industrial applications because of its chemical reactivity and adaptability.

Caprolactam is a white, crystalline organic compound with the chemical formula C₆H₁₁NO, primarily used as the key raw material for producing nylon-6 fibers and resins. It is manufactured through the oxidation of cyclohexanone or cyclohexane, followed by conversion to cyclohexanone oxime and subsequent rearrangement. Nylon-6 derived from caprolactam is widely used in textiles, carpets, industrial yarns, engineering plastics, and films due to its strength, elasticity, and durability. Caprolactam is soluble in water and many organic solvents, with a slightly amine-like odor. While valuable industrially, it can be irritating to the skin, eyes, and respiratory system, requiring careful handling and storage.

The white or off-white crystalline powder known as disulfiram (C₁₀H₂₀N₂S₄) is mostly used as a drug to treat chronic alcoholism. It discourages drinking by blocking the aldehyde dehydrogenase enzyme, which results in an unpleasant reaction when alcohol is ingested. With a molecular weight of 296.54 g/mol and a melting point between 69 and 72 °C, disulfiram is essentially insoluble in water but only weakly soluble in alcohol. Often marketed under the brand name Antabuse, it is utilized as a component of all-encompassing alcohol dependence treatment programs and is taken under medical supervision. Adherence and the patient's dedication to sobriety are essential to its effectiveness.
